The night Nicho Hynes accepted the Dally M Medal in 2022, it was the culmination of a journey that had taken him from Melbourne Storm understudy to the most creative halfback in the NRL. At Cronulla, Hynes has found his stage. His kicking game is precise and varied, his running threat keeps defensive lines honest, and his ability to organise an attack with the composure of a seasoned general makes him the heartbeat of everything the Sharks do with the ball. What sets Hynes apart is the quiet confidence he carries into the biggest moments โ the poise under pressure that separates good halfbacks from great ones.

Player Profile
In 110 games and 35 tries, Hynes has established himself as one of the premier halves in the competition. His skill set is complete โ kicking, running, passing, organising โ and his influence on the Sharksโ attack is immeasurable. In 2026, Hynes continues to pull the strings at Cronulla, the Dally M winner whose creative brilliance gives the Sharks genuine title aspirations.
